What is ground staff?

Ground staff are airport employees responsible for assisting passengers and ensuring the smooth operation of airport activities on the ground. Their duties include checking in passengers, handling baggage, providing information, guiding passengers through security procedures, and coordinating with flight crews. Ground staff play a vital role in maintaining safety, efficiency, and customer service at airports. They often work in shifts to cover various flight schedules and interact directly with travelers to resolve any issues.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as ground staff?

To thrive as Ground Staff, you typically need a high school diploma or equivalent, strong organizational abilities, and knowledge of airport operations and safety procedures. Familiarity with airline reservation systems, baggage handling equipment, and security screening devices is important. Excellent communication, problem-solving skills, and customer service orientation set outstanding Ground Staff apart. These skills are vital to ensure smooth airport operations, passenger satisfaction, and compliance with safety regulations.

What are some typical challenges ground staff face during peak travel seasons, and how can they effectively manage them?

During peak travel seasons, Ground Staff often encounter increased passenger volumes, tighter schedules, and a higher likelihood of last-minute changes or disruptions. These challenges require strong time management, the ability to stay calm under pressure, and excellent communication skills to coordinate with both passengers and airline teams. Proactively anticipating passenger needs, staying updated on flight statuses, and working closely with colleagues can help Ground Staff deliver smooth operations even during the busiest periods.

Ground Staff and Cabin Crew both work in the airline industry but have different roles. Ground Staff primarily handle airport operations, baggage, and customer service on the ground, while Cabin Crew focus on passenger safety and service during flights. Both roles require customer service skills and relevant certifications, but their work environments and responsibilities differ significantly.

How do you become a ground staff?

To become a ground staff member, candidates typically need a high school diploma or equivalent, good communication skills, and customer service experience. Relevant certifications or training in airport operations or safety procedures can be beneficial, and fluency in multiple languages is often preferred. The role may require physical stamina and the ability to work flexible hours, including weekends and holidays.

SUMMARY OVERVIEW
The Ramp Lead is responsible for overseeing and coordinating activities on the airport ramp to ensure the efficient and safe handling of aircraft and ground services. This role involves coordinating with a team of ramp personnel, handling the loading and unloading of baggage and cargo, and ensuring adherence to safety and operational procedures. The Ramp Lead will communicate with flight crews, ground staff, and operations control to facilitate timely aircraft turnarounds.
R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Guide inbound/outbound aircraft to and from gate without damage or injury
  • Communicate effectively with flight crews, ground staff, and operations control to ensure timely aircraft turnarounds
  • Conduct regular inspections of the ramp area and equipment to maintain safety standards
  • Respond to operational challenges and troubleshoot issues as they arise
  • Train and mentor ramp staff on best practices and safety protocols
  • Maintain accurate records of ramp activities and incidents
  • Ensure compliance with all DOT regulations as required and guidelines, including overseeing the safe and legal operation of airport vehicles, equipment, and personnel involved in airside and landside operations
  • Safely lift, unload, load and transport baggage, mail and cargo to and from aircraft and airport
  • Protect baggage and other equipment from damage, loss and weather conditions
  • Ability to drive and operate heavy ground equipment, such as tugs, cargo carts, service trucks and belt loaders
  • Assist in record keeping and documentation to ensure correct routing of baggage
  • Use of personal protective equipment, including hearing protection
  • Maintain area cleanliness
  • Execute daily quality control checks on equipment
  • Exemplify PrimeFlight customer service and safety standards
  • Perform any additional duties as assigned by management
